This 1.44 MB drive was better than expected!!! Nov 04, 2010
By EJG Like everyone else, I was looking for a way to read and save data from legacy 1.44 MB 3.5" floppies. After reading reviews on all the available External USB 1.44 MB drives, and seeing comments about the cheaper Teac drives not reading the low density floppies, I decided to go with the more expensive option from Iomega. I only have high density floppies so I can't confirm operation with the low density ones but other reviewers have. This Iomega drive is reading my 10 to 15 year old floppies perfectly. Another surprising thing is how quiet this drive operates. Very smooth and near silent operation. Unlike the picture on Amazon, and to my preference, the drive is all matte black in color. This is one solid and well-built drive. Windows 7 Pro recognized the drive and installed the driver within about 5 seconds from plugging it in. I'd probably never need it, but I like this drive so much, that I'm thinking about ordering a spare.

This is the USB floppy drive to get Dec 29, 2010
By Arthur Stoppe If you need a USB floppy disk drive because your computer doesn't support an internal one (which is the case with most new computers)then this is the one to get. It costs a lot more than the other brands out there, but it is worth it as it is well made and works the way it's supposed to. If your computer's BIOS supports booting from a USB device you may even be able to boot your computer from this drive! My ASUS P5Q Pro Turbo motherboard supports this, and it's handy for running certain utilities such as Memtest 86 or 86+, or motherboard BIOS updating programs that need to boot from a diskette.
